About me: Creating possible realities 02

Regina (Madrid, 1984).

Creative director of the exhibition White Gold for Madrid design Festival 2025.

She directs side specific installation projects and collaborates with interior design studios for contract and retail projects. Her work can be seen in the Hall of the Hotel Nobu in Barcelona, collaborating with Rockwellgroup, the hall of the Hotel AYSLA Kingston in Mallorca and the hall of the Zambra in Malaga.

His collaboration with Adolfo Domínguez is relevant with the sculptural intervention in 10 of its shops in Spain, Portugal and Turkey.

New Creative Environments Award of the Madrid Design Festival and Amazon in 2024, Award for the vanguard in craftsmanship of the Comunitat Valenciana 2023, Finalist in the national awards of craftsmanship 2023 in the category of entrepreneurship.

In 2023 her work participated in the exhibition Alma y Materia, curated by Rubén Torres, representing Spain at the Cheonju Biennale, South Korea.

She graduated in Fine Arts from the University of Barcelona, specialising in Sculpture and Textiles in 2011. She studied a Master’s Degree in Art Education for Social Inclusion at the Complutense University of Madrid. She also has a degree in Artistic Photography from the Escuela de Arte nº 10 in Madrid and has studied haute couture at the Koefia School in Rome.

During her academic career she has obtained exchange scholarships with the University of Altea, Mimar Sinan University in Spain, Mimar Sinan University in Madrid and Mimar Sinan University in Istanbul.

Prizes, curatorships and major collaborations

Creative direction and sculptures for the exhibition Oro blanco as part of Tejiendo redes, Madrid Design Festival.

Creative direction of the installation for Kave at the AD Magazine 2024 awards.

Artist in residence at Domaine du Boisbuchet, France.

Winner of the New Creative Environments Award at the Madrid Design Festival and Amazon 2024.

Award to the Vanguard of the Crafts Centre of the Valencian Community 2023.

Exhibition in all editions of Xtant Mallorca, a meeting of international textile heritage.

Madrid Design Festival 2024 and 2023 in the exhibition Madre Natura in 2023.

‘Soul and Matter’ representing Spain in South Korea among other exhibitions in 2023.

Feature exhibition: Wisdom and Nature at the Chriesties Gallery in New York and London.

Artisan member of the International Homo Faber Guide to Craft Excellence of the Michelangelo Foundation, Switzerland since 2022.

She is a member of the galleries Unico (Barcelona), ADDictions Design (Marbella) and Ett-rum (Madrid).

Collaborating with Adolfo Domínguez with installations and sculptures for specific shops from 2022.

She is represented as an artist and designer by Galeria ABaArt Lab Mallorca since 2021.
